Pakistan faces a significant crisis of trust, particularly concerning its judicial system. Years of reports of corruption, bias and perceived meddling from various elements have eroded public confidence read more in the fairness and impartiality of its courts. This deficit of trust impedes the rule of law, fuels frustration amongst citizens, and ultimately weakens the stability of the nation . Rebuilding this crucial faith requires meaningful reforms, including greater transparency, accountability of officials, and a dedication to ensure equal application of the law for all, regardless of background .

Accessible Legal Assistance
In Pakistan , pro bono legal support represents a crucial support system for those in need. A significant number of individuals, comprising women, minors , and villagers, often lack the capacity to obtain sufficient legal guidance. This disparity can leave them powerless when facing justice system issues, ranging from property disputes to criminal charges . Groups providing this help play a critical role in ensuring justice and protecting the interests of those least able to seek it themselves .
